COMPUTER INSTRUCTIONS

B. PRESET PROGRAMS (P2 to P7)

STEP 1: POWER ON

Pedaling or press one of MODE, ENTER, and START / STOP buttons.

STEP 2 : SELECT PROGRAM

Press "/" buttons until the desired program is displayed.

STEP 3: SET THE PROGRAM TIME OR DISTANCE, CALORIES, AND AGE

Press the ENTER button, the TIME function mode will appear with the display flashing "0:00". Use "/" buttons to set the program time, from 5 minutes up to 99 minutes with 1 minute increments. Or, you can keep TIME as "0:00" and press the ENTER button to enter the mode to set the DISTANCE. Use "/" buttons to set the DISTANCE, from 1 mile up to 999 miles with 1 mile increments. Press the ENTER button to enter the mode to set the CALORIES. Use "/" buttons to set the CALORIES, from 10 cal. up to 9990 cal. with 10 cal. increments.

Press the ENTER button to enter the mode to set the AGE. Use "/" buttons to set the AGE, from 10 up to 99 years old. Please note that although the computer is designed for children down to 10 years old, this product is not designed for children.

NOTE: With the input of age, the computer will display a TARGET HEART RATE when running the program. The TARGET HEART RATE is 85% of your Maximum Heart Rate, and your Maximum Heart Rate is (220 - AGE). If your pulse is equal to or greater than the TARGET HEART RATE during workout, the value of HEART RATE will keep flashing. Please note that this is a warning for you to slow down or lower the Level of resistance.

STEP 4 : START TO WORKOUT

Now you are ready to begin exercising. The program will not start until you press the START/STOP button.

C. BODY FAT PROGRAM (P8)

STEP 1: POWER ON

Pedaling or press one of MODE, ENTER, and START / STOP buttons.

STEP 2 : SELECT PROGRAM

Press "/" buttons until PROGRAM 8 is displayed.

STEP 3: SELECT GENDER AND INPUT YOUR HEIGHT, WEIGHT, AND AGE

Press the ENTER button, the GENDER mode will appear with the display flashing " ". Use "/" buttons to display the correct gender. Press the ENTER button and use "/" buttons to set the values of your HEIGHT, WEIGHT, and AGE. After you input your age and press the ENTER button, the "PROGRAM 8" display will keep flashing.

STEP 4: CALCULATE YOUR BODY FAT

Press the the START/STOP button and hold the pulse sensors on the handlebar with both hands. A few seconds later, the computer will show the information for BODY FAT%, BMR, BMI, BODY TYPE, and the suitable program profile for you. Press the START/STOP button to start to workout. Now, you can see your TARGET HEART RATE. Always try to keep your HEART RATE readout close to the TARGET HEART RATE during workout.

NOTE: 1. If you don't hold the pulse sensors on the handlebar with both hands properly, the pulse sensors won't be able to pick up the signals. The computer will display an error message "E3". Press the the START/STOP button and hold the pulse sensors with both hands properly to calculate again.

2.The values calculated or measured are for average people and they are for exercise purposes. They are not for medical purposes.
